Welcome to the inaugural edition of Walker County Weekly Community News, a local newspaper focused on providing coverage of Walker County's news, events, businesses, schools, churches and residents.

The Walker County Community News will be published and delivered every Wednesday. The newspaper is also available online at http://community2.timesfreepress.com.

With a commitment to Walker County, the Community News is specifically interested in the people and places that make the area special and distinct. Each week we will try to illuminate the important events in the community while also detailing local people, businesses, artisans and organizations that help make the community prosper.

To help us further that mission, readers are encouraged to submit information for calendar listings, event briefs and potential stories.

Along with timely announcements about the various club, school, church and civic activities taking place in the area, we look for local feature stories about interesting people, community services, homes, cooks, arts and entertainment, businesses and much more. A staff of writers including Timara Frassrand, Mike O'Neal and Katie Ward will be centered on Walker County each week to provide informative and interesting articles about you and your neighbors.
